#1d8f62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d8f62 is composed of 11.4% red, 56.1%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.5%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 156.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 33.7%. #1d8f62 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affc4 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#1d8f62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d8f62 has RGB values of R:29, G:143,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1937250.

Shades and Tints of #1d8f62
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d09 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.
